SAN DIEGO--(BUSINESS WIRE)--July 7, 1998--The following was released today by Milberg Weiss
Bershad Hynes & Lerach LLP. Notice to purchasers of the following securities for the following class
periods:

CORPORATION

Evolving Systems Inc. (NASDAQ:EVOL) 05/12/98-06/17/98
FPA Medical Management Inc. (NASDAQ:FPAM) 02/27/97-06/18/98
Advanced Fibre Comm. Inc. (NASDAQ:AFCI) 06/03/97-06/30/98
Smart Modular Technologies Inc. (NASDAQ:SMOD) 07/01/97-05/21/98
First Alliance Corp. (NASDAQ:FACO) 04/24/97-05/27/98
Aspec Technology Inc. (NASDAQ:ASPC) 04/28/98-06/25/98
Advanced Tissue Sciences Inc. (NASDAQ:ATIS) 01/13/97-06/11/98
Hybrid Networks Inc. (NASDAQ:HYBR) 11/12/97-06/01/98

You should be aware that class action complaints involving the securities of the above companies were
filed on behalf of investors by the law firm of Milberg Weiss Bershad Hynes & Lerach LLP ("Milberg
Weiss"), often in cooperation with other major experienced securities firms.
